Hard-paste porcelain painted en camaïeu in crimson
Brief description
Tea canister and cover of hard-paste porcelain painted en camaïeu in crimson, Zürich faience and porcelain factory, Zürich, ca. 1765-1791
Physical description
Tea canister and cover of hard-paste porcelain painted en camaïeu in crimson with designs adapted from Japanese Kakiemon ware
